The Postgraduate Certificate in Wireless Communication Innovation in Computing is a specialized program designed to equip students with advanced knowledge and skills in wireless communication technologies, particularly in the context of computing.
This program focuses on the development of innovative solutions in wireless communication systems, including wireless sensor networks, wireless local area networks, and wireless wide area networks. Students will learn about the latest advancements in wireless communication technologies, such as 5G, IoT, and edge computing.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to design, develop, and implement wireless communication systems, as well as to analyze and optimize wireless communication networks. Students will also gain expertise in wireless communication protocols, such as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, and Zigbee.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Wireless Communication Innovation in Computing is typically one year full-time or two years part-time. The program is designed to be flexible and can be completed in a shorter or longer timeframe depending on the student's needs.
